# utils/pdf_processor.py | |
""" | |
PDF processing module for ACRES RAG Platform. | |
Handles PDF file processing, text extraction, and page rendering. | |
""" | |
import datetime | |
import json | |
import logging | |
import os | |
import re | |
from typing import Dict, List, Optional | |
from llama_index.readers.docling import DoclingReader | |
import fitz | |
from PIL import Image | |
from slugify import slugify | |
logger = logging.getLogger(__name__) | |
reader = DoclingReader() | |
class PDFProcessor: | |
def __init__(self, upload_dir: str = "data/uploads"): | |
"""Initialize PDFProcessor with upload directory.""" | |
self.upload_dir = upload_dir | |
os.makedirs(upload_dir, exist_ok=True) | |
self.current_page = 0 | |
def is_references_page(self, text: str) -> bool: | |
""" | |
Check if the page appears to be a references/bibliography page. | |
""" | |
# Common section headers for references | |
ref_headers = [ | |
r"^references\s*$", | |
r"^bibliography\s*$", | |
r"^works cited\s*$", | |
r"^citations\s*$", | |
r"^cited literature\s*$", | |
] | |
# Check first few lines of the page | |
first_lines = text.lower().split("\n")[:3] | |
first_block = " ".join(first_lines) | |
# Check for reference headers | |
for header in ref_headers: | |
if re.search(header, first_block, re.IGNORECASE): | |
return True | |
# Check for reference-like patterns (e.g., [1] Author, et al.) | |
ref_patterns = [ | |
r"^\[\d+\]", # [1] style | |
r"^\d+\.", # 1. style | |
r"^[A-Z][a-z]+,\s+[A-Z]\.", # Author, I. style | |
] | |
ref_pattern_count = 0 | |
lines = text.split("\n")[:10] # Check first 10 lines | |
for line in lines: | |
line = line.strip() | |
if any(re.match(pattern, line) for pattern in ref_patterns): | |
ref_pattern_count += 1 | |
# If multiple reference-like patterns are found, likely a references page | |
return ref_pattern_count >= 3 | |
def detect_references_start(self, doc: fitz.Document) -> Optional[int]: | |
""" | |
Detect the page where references section starts. | |
Returns the page number or None if not found. | |
""" | |
for page_num in range(len(doc)): | |
page = doc[page_num] | |
text = page.get_text() | |
if self.is_references_page(text): | |
logger.info(f"Detected references section starting at page {page_num}") | |
return page_num | |
return None | |
